Summary of Programme:
During the programme, my teammate and I developed a Python-based ETF arbitrage strategy, modelling the price divergence between the ETF market price and its theoretical NAV as a mean-reverting process. The strategy incorporated adaptive statistical thresholds, position-aware entry logic, and dual exit conditions to manage inventory risk effectively.
Through conversations with Goldman Sachs’ quantitative researchers and traders, I gained first-hand insight into how mathematical frameworks — from stochastic processes to statistical inference — are continuously applied and refined in real-world trading environments.
